WebAustralia is about 26 times bigger than Italy. In 2024 (or based on the latest year of data): Australia’s life expectancy at birth was 83.0 years – above the OECD average of 80.6 years, and the sixth highest among OECD countries. The highest life expectancy was in Japan, where people could expect to live 84.4 years at birth.
